Award Marathon Medals: Style, Composition, and Significance These sought-after marathon medals represent a major achievement for athletes. The aesthetic often incorporates representative graphics, such as athletic figures or the city hosting the competition. Commonly, they are crafted from durable materials, most frequently brass or bronze, and may feature a gold finish for added status. The value isn't just about the material's inherent price, but also its emotional meaning to the recipient, which can fluctuate considerably more info based on the race's standing and the athlete's individual journey. Collecting Marathon Medals: A Passionate Hobby For many runners, completing a marathon isn't just about the competition; it’s about the keepsake – the coveted marathon token. Collecting these impressive pieces has blossomed into a growing hobby, drawing in enthusiasts from all corners of the world. It’s more than just accumulating bronze discs; it’s a tangible record of personal success and dedication to the sport. Some specialize on collecting medals from specific regions, like Europe , while others seek medals from races with unique aesthetics . A hobby often involves interacting with fellow runners, trading stories and sometimes medals.
